Latest Patents
One of his latest patents is a dynamic balance testing device designed to enhance the accuracy of balance assessments. This innovative device features a vibrating unit that rotatably holds a specimen—specifically a predetermined rotating body. It incorporates a first spring that elastically supports the vibrating unit and restricts its displacement along the rotation axis. Additionally, the design includes at least three second springs, which provide further support in a direction orthogonal to the rotation axis. The engineering ensures that the projection of the center of gravity of the specimen aligns with the attachment point of the first spring, allowing for precise balance testing.
